A multiple catheter assembly ( 100 ) including a first catheter ( 110 ) having a first proximal end region ( 112 ), a first distal end region ( 114 ) terminating in a first distal tip ( 116 ), and an outer surface ( 120 ) defining at least a first lumen ( 122 ) extending longitudinally therethrough between a first distal and a first proximal opening. The assembly ( 100 ) also includes a second catheter ( 130 ) having a second proximal end region ( 132 ), a second distal end region ( 134 ) terminating in a second distal tip ( 136 ), and a second outer surface ( 140 ) defining at least a second lumen ( 142 ) extending longitudinally therethrough between a second distal and a second proximal opening. The first ( 122 ) and second ( 142 ) lumens are independent from each other for facilitating simultaneous flow in opposite directions. The outer surfaces ( 120,140 ) of the first and second catheters are releasably joined for allowing the first and second distal tips ( 116,136 ) and first and second proximal end regions ( 112,132 ) to be at least partially longitudinally split from each other. A method of inserting the catheter assembly ( 100 ) is also provided that includes a method of attaching a hub to the catheter assembly. |
